LTTE murders Poosari who garlanded President
BATTICALOA: Selliah Kurukkal Parameshwaran, the Chief Poosari of the
Santhiveli Pulleyar Kovil, Batticaloa who garlanded President Mahinda
Rajapaksa during his recent visit to Vakarai was shot dead by three LTTE
gunmen just outside his residence last night, military sources told the
Daily News.
According to sources, three LTTE gunmen entered the Santhiveli
Pulleyar Kovil and had taken him to the backyard of his residence saying
that they need to question him and shot him using a T 56 weapon. He was
63 years old and was a father of three.
According to initial reports the LTTE gunmen had taken him out of his
residence at 8.45 pm while he was having his dinner.
According to family members the gunmen had mentioned that they were
from the LTTE and they needed to question the Poosari in connection with
the garlanding of President Mahinda Rajapaksa on his arrival at Vakarai
on February 3.
Eravur Police are conducting investigations.
